scfm69 said:
I can duct the air from the living space. That fluctuates room to room depending on if we’re just using the furnace or have a fire. The air from the warmth of the fire would be too much. What do ppl in colder climates do? Put their heat on 72?
Click to expand...
I cycle 2 tents through the winter. In a few weeks I will start the plants to fill my second 5 x 5 tent. Plants in the 2 tents will be about 45 days apart. This allows the heat from my lights in veg to heat the room during the dark cycle of the tent that is in flower. I also run a small electric heater connected to a seedling mat thermostat to regulate temp. My plants are in my basement where winter night time temps without any grows are at about 58-60 degrees. Michigan is known for cold winters.

growsince79 said:
IMO the vpd chart is for lettuce not buds. If I flower 75f @70%rh bad things will happen. If I ignore the vpd chart and flower 75f @ 45rh, fat sticky stinky buds happen.
Click to expand...
At 70% RH, your plants would struggle to transpire. VPD is about dialing in the transpiration rate. An old grower like you is going to respond to what you're seeing ... and then tweak your environment to improve transpiration. The science is solid. You're already doing it without checking temperatures ... If you do, don't use the lettuce vpd chart. It's for lettuce.
